Our People Function works across brands, geographies, and cultures to support one global Maersk. As a People Advisor, you’ll play a vital part in our success, supporting our employees with their HR queries so that they can focus on their own jobs. Taking care of their issues, whether big or small, and making sure they get a great employee experience in every interaction with HR.
A People Advisor is responsible for acting as first point of contact for employees and take ownership of managing each HR related query to conclusion to deliver a positive employee experience.
We are looking to hire a new colleague in our People Advisor Team in Warsaw, Poland.
